iis服务器助手广告广告
返回顶部
首页 > 资讯 > 精选 >oracle存储过程中游标怎么使用
  • 291
分享到

oracle存储过程中游标怎么使用

oracle 2023-09-09 05:09:18 291人浏览 泡泡鱼
摘要

在oracle存储过程中,可以使用游标来处理查询结果集。游标允许逐行处理查询结果,类似于使用指针遍历数据。以下是在Oracle存储过

oracle存储过程中,可以使用游标来处理查询结果集。游标允许逐行处理查询结果,类似于使用指针遍历数据。
以下是在Oracle存储过程中使用游标的基本步骤:
1. 声明游标变量:在存储过程的声明部分,使用`CURSOR`关键字声明游标变量。例如:
```
DECLARE
CURSOR cursor_name IS SELECT column1, column2 FROM table_name;
```
这里的`cursor_name`是游标变量的名称,`SELECT`语句是要执行的查询语句。
2. 打开游标:在存储过程的执行部分,使用`OPEN`语句打开游标。例如:
```
OPEN cursor_name;
```
3. 循环处理游标结果:使用`FETCH`语句循环获取游标的下一行数据,并进行处理。例如:
```
LOOP
FETCH cursor_name INTO variable1, variable2;
-- 进行数据处理
END LOOP;
```
这里的`variable1`和`variable2`是用来存储查询结果的变量。
4. 关闭游标:在存储过程的结束部分,使用`CLOSE`语句关闭游标。例如:
```
CLOSE cursor_name;
```
通过以上步骤,可以在Oracle存储过程中使用游标来处理查询结果集。根据实际需求,还可以结合条件语句、循环语句等进行更复杂的数据处理操作。

--结束END--

本文标题: oracle存储过程中游标怎么使用

本文链接: https://www.lsjlt.com/news/400949.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• oracle存储过程中游标怎么使用
    在Oracle存储过程中,可以使用游标来处理查询结果集。游标允许逐行处理查询结果,类似于使用指针遍历数据。以下是在Oracle存储过...
    99+
    2023-09-09
    oracle
  • oracle存储过程游标怎么使用
    在Oracle存储过程中,使用游标可以迭代访问结果集。以下是使用游标的一般步骤:1. 声明游标:在存储过程的声明部分,使用`CURS...
    99+
    2023-09-21
    oracle
  • mysql存储过程中游标怎么用
    这篇文章将为大家详细讲解有关mysql存储过程中游标怎么用,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。 DELIMITER $$USE `...
    99+
    2024-04-02
  • oracle存储过程的游标是什么
    Oracle存储过程中的游标是一种用于遍历和访问查询结果集的数据库对象。游标可以被认为是指向某个查询结果集的指针,通过游标可以逐行地...
    99+
    2023-08-24
    oracle
  • MYSQL存储过程开发中怎么使用游标嵌套
    本篇内容介绍了“MYSQL存储过程开发中怎么使用游标嵌套”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!在实...
    99+
    2024-04-02
  • 如何在mysql存储过程中使用游标
    本篇文章给大家分享的是有关如何在mysql存储过程中使用游标,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。在处理存储过程中的结果集时,可以使用...
    99+
    2024-04-02
  • mysql存储过程中游标怎样遍历
    这篇文章主要介绍了mysql存储过程中游标怎样遍历,具有一定借鉴价值,需要的朋友可以参考下。希望大家阅读完这篇文章后大有收获。下面让小编带着大家一起了解一下。mysql存储过程中游标遍历的方法:首先取值,取...
    99+
    2024-04-02
  • MySql存储过程和游标的使用实例
    目录前言1.创建存储过程。2.查看存储过程名称3.调用存储过程4.删除存储过程总结前言 这里存储过程和游标的定义和作用就不介绍了,网上挺多的,只通过简单的介绍,然后用个案例让大家快速...
    99+
    2024-04-02
  • mysql:存储过程-游标遍历
    前情提要 因工作需要要写一些sql脚本,进行一些数据的修改。 直接在数据库ide中写sql涉及就到一些逻辑的判断。 比如判断根据参数判断这条数据存不存在,不存在插入,存在则删除。 最开始查搜索引擎mysql是支持if判断的,根据格式写完...
    99+
    2023-09-27
    java 后端 mysql sql
  • Oracle中怎么创建和使用存储过程
    在Oracle中,可以使用PL/SQL语言来创建和使用存储过程。以下是一个简单的示例: 创建存储过程: CREATE OR RE...
    99+
    2024-04-19
    Oracle
  • mysql存储过程的游标有什么作用
    这篇文章主要讲解了“mysql存储过程的游标有什么作用”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“mysql存储过程的游标有什么作用”吧! ...
    99+
    2024-04-02
  • MySQL-存储过程、流程控制、游标
    存储过程 存储过程概述 1.产生背景 开发过程总,经常会遇到重复使用某一功能的情况 2.解决办法 MySQL引人了存储过程(Stored Procedure)这一技术 3.存储过程 存储过程就是一条或...
    99+
    2023-10-11
    sql
  • MYsql-存储过程-游标的嵌套
    在ITPUB: http://www.itpub.net/viewthread.phptid=1134085&pid=13049789&page=1&extra=#pid13049789上有人发贴说游标不...
    99+
    2024-04-02
  • oracle中如何使用存储过程
    这期内容当中小编将会给大家带来有关oracle中如何使用存储过程,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。 1.基本结构 CREATE OR REPLAC&...
    99+
    2024-04-02
  • oracle中存储过程如何使用
    今天就跟大家聊聊有关oracle中存储过程如何使用,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。一. 使用for循环游标:遍历所有职位为经理的雇员1...
    99+
    2024-04-02
  • Mybatis中怎么调用Oracle存储过程
    Mybatis中怎么调用Oracle存储过程,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。1:调用无参数的存储过程。创建存储过...
    99+
    2024-04-02
  • Oracle中怎么调用Java存储过程
    这期内容当中小编将会给大家带来有关Oracle中怎么调用Java存储过程,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。一、如何创建java存储过程?通常有三种方法来创建java存储过程。1. 使用orac...
    99+
    2023-06-17
  • mysql的存储过程、游标 、事务有什么用
    这篇文章给大家分享的是有关mysql的存储过程、游标 、事务有什么用的内容。小编觉得挺实用的,因此分享给大家做个参考。一起跟随小编过来看看吧。mysql的存储过程、游标 、事务实例详解下面是自己曾经编写过的...
    99+
    2024-04-02
  • 怎么调用Oracle存储过程
    这篇文章给大家介绍怎么调用Oracle存储过程,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。Oracle的存储过程语法如下:create procedure 存储过...
    99+
    2024-04-02
  • oracle怎么调用存储过程
    要调用Oracle存储过程,可以按照以下步骤进行操作:1. 创建存储过程:在Oracle数据库中创建存储过程。可以使用PL/SQL开...
    99+
    2023-08-23
    oracle
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作